For the 2003–2004 school year the Igarashi family chose to enroll their daughter Coie in the CLASS program. Coie’s mother Jenefer is the Senior Editor of The Old Schoolhouse™ Magazine, which has a printing of 22,000 magazines each quarter. Excerpts from reviews written by Jenefer and her daughter follow below. |
| |
“This year we (the Igarashi family) decided to set out and learn what we
can about distance learning programs. We chose the Christian Liberty
Academy School System, or CLASS, and so far we have been very pleased.
Previously, in the Summer ’03 issue I (Jenefer) highlighted some of the
reasons we chose the CLASS program. (one of the biggest pro’s was the
great low price). Now that we have been working through the program for
a semester, we fell like we are getting a real feel for ‘who’ CLASS
is. I have to say that this has been a very good experience. We promptly
received the entire curriculum and the results back from Coie’s assessment/placement
test (they use CAT). We were happy with how they matched her curriculum
to her personal ‘test level’; she was able to dive right in
at a comfortable pace. She has accessed the online tutorial/help line
and customer service (by email). I’ve included her observations on those
services beneath my report. This month we will be mailing in our first
set of tests for grading by CLASS. They will be sending us quarterly
report cards and keeping cumulative records of test scores, final grades
and Coie’s academic history... Distance learning certainly takes some
of the pressure off with regards to record keeping and transcripts, among
other things.”
– Jenefer Igarashi, Senior Editor |
“Using the CLASS distance learning program this school year has been very
beneficial. There are many helpful tools including the algebra email help-line,
online algebra tutorial, and customer service. I used the customer service
e-mail when I first stated and they responded surprisingly fast with all
the answers to my questions. The online algebra tutorial is also really
great. Not all of the lessons in the book are included, but what they do
have is extremely helpful, giving many examples and explaining everything
clearly. I have not yet needed to use the help-line but if it’s anything
like their other services then it’s sure to be advantageous. There is a
CLASS lesson planner that can be used on your computer, which makes recording
everything much easier and faster. It has many features such as the weekly
lesson planner, prayer journal, weekly chore list, high school and elementary
academic transcript, field trip worksheet, attendance record, reading record
sheet, and many more features. It makes everything much easier and hassle-free.
I think that anybody who uses the CLASS program will be very impressed.”
– Coie Igarashi, Jenefer’s daughter |
